Common Wlms.exe Errors on Windows
Encountering errors associated with wlms.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to wlms.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.
- Wlms.exe - System Error: This error is usually associated with missing or corrupted system files required by wlms.exe.
- Error 0xc0000142: This error message appears when an application wasn't able to start correctly, often due to issues in the software itself, corrupted files, or problems with Windows registry.
- Unable to Start Correctly (0xc000007b): This alert appears when the application cannot initiate correctly, often resulting from a mismatch between the Windows version and the application regarding 32-bit and 64-bit configurations.
- Insufficient System Resources Exist to Complete the Requested Service: This error message shows up when the system lacks the necessary resources to carry out the service requested, possibly due to overuse of system memory or high CPU usage.
- Wlms.exe Application Error: This error message indicates a problem encountered by the executable application during its execution. This could be due to software bugs, corrupted files, or conflicts with other programs.

Update Your Device Drivers
How to guide on updating the device drivers on your system. wlms.exe errors can be caused by outdated or incompatible drivers.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Device Manager
in the search bar and press Enter.
-
In the Device Manager window, locate the device whose driver you want to update.
-
Click on the arrow or plus sign next to the device category to expand it.
-
Right-click on the device and select Update driver.
-
In the next window, select Search automatically for updated driver software.
-
Follow the prompts to install the driver update.
